** MOVIE NEWS **

"BATMAN: YEAR ONE" - Scarecrow Manson!

'Variety' magazine has reported that shock rocker Marilyn Manson is in line to play The Scarecrow in Darren Aronofsky's "Batman: Year One". So many Batman and Superman franchises in development hell right now, it's difficult to keep up!

"THE CROW 4" - Lazarus Is Born!

The screenplay for "The Crow 4" has been rewritten to become a standalone movie project entitled "Lazarus" - about a man who turns on his best friend, owing to some creepy supernatural forces, after the two are involved with a gruesome crime. The potential movie should be directed by Tony Bui ("Green Dragon")

"DUMB & DUMBER 2" - Director Does Dumb!

Troy Miller has been hired by 'New Line Cinema' to direct the sequel to "Dumb & Dumber" - actually a prequel entitled "Dumb & Dumberer"!

Cover "BLACK PANTHER" - Snipes Signs On?

Wesley Snipes has commented on the long-gestating possibility of him playing Black Panther in a movie. He said: "We're trying to get it prepared for production next year, so we'll see. You know how this movie business goes. Will Smith could be in the role, I could wake up tomorrow... 'Will's doing Black Panther!'"

The actor also confirmed he is interested in doing "Blade 3" should the project be written and greenlit.

"THE FAST & THE FURIOUS 2" - Villain Cast!

Cole Hauser ("Pitch Black") has been cast the villain in John Singleton's sequel to "The Fast & The Furious" - which starred Hauser's "Pitch Black" co-star Vin Diesel!

Cover "FREDDY vs JASON" - Englund Speaks!

Robert Englund (Freddy Krueger) has spoken about the upcoming horror crossover "Freddy Vs Jason". He said: "My [current] script dates back to July and boy, it's a good script. It has the one thing that I felt it had to have - we have to get into Jason's nightmares. Whatever's going on, whatever remains of his synapse and psyche, we have to get into that. And they really exploit that in this."

"There's also a wonderful set piece at a rave that's just an amazing, amazing sequence... Freddy needs Jason. He manipulates him, and then it all starts to fray at the edge. We've really returned to core Freddy in this one. It wouldn't be Freddy if he didn't crack some jokes, and he does in 'Freddy vs. Jason,' but they're a little meaner [and] kind of politically incorrect."

It has also been confirmed that Destiny's Child singer Kelly Rowland has joined the cast as the film's female lead! She will play just one of a group of teenagers who decide to trick Freddy Kruger and Jason Voorhees into fighting one another, in the hope of destroying both child-killers.

"KILL BILL" - Pei Mei Cast!

Quentin Tarantino will not star in his new movie "Kill Bill" as oriental Kung Fu master Pei Mei. The role will now go to Gordon Liu ("5 Masters Of Death") - a legendary Kung Fu movie veteran.

Julia Louis-Dreyfuss has also been cast as Sofie Fatale, while Chiria Kuriyama will play GoGo Yubari.

"LEAGUE OF EXTRAORDINARY GENTLEMEN" - Flood Status!

Flooding in Prague halted production on Steven Norrington's "The League Of Extraordinary Gentlemen" picture last week.

Producer Don Murphy has this to say: "We had to shut down shooting Tuesday at 10:45 Czech time. Sixty percent of the crew were in the Hilton which was evacuated after the lobby became filled with a foot of water"

"The Nautilus set, quite possibly the most beautiful set I have ever laid eyes on, was very close to the river and we cannot get to it but is likely to be waterlogged. Many of the actors were in beautiful apartments by the river that had to be evacuated on Monday. The remaining actors were in the Four Seasons which was evacuated late Monday. The rains continue. The film is definitely not shooting until next week at the earliest."

In related news, the movie's screenwriter James Robinson has spoken about the difficult task in adapting the comic-book for the screen@ "It's truer to the comic in spirit than in plot. I added two characters: Dorian Gray and Tom Sawyer... added Dorian Gray because he actually helped the story. I won't reveal the twist and, because of commerce, I think '20th Century Fox' felt more comfortable making a movie that was very expensive knowing that there was a young American character."

"[Alan Moore] is the greatest comic book writer of all time. Taking that into account, "League" is one of his great works. Is it better than "Watchmen"? It depends on what you prefer. That gets into relative opinions. "League" is definitely one of my favorite works that he has done."

Cover "HELLRAISER VI" - Tearing Souls Apart Once More!

'Cinescape' interviewed Tim Day - the co-writer of "Hellraiser: Deader" - about the new movie's plot: "We've taken a script called 'Deader' that Neal Marshall ('13 Ghosts') Stevens sold to 'Dimension' almost 2 years ago as a spec, and I've rewritten it to incorporate the 'Hellraiser' mythology."

"Our heroine is a female reporter for a London newspaper, who is sent to Bucharest to investigate an underground suicide cult known as the 'Deaders.' She is quickly drawn into their dark world and soon can see no way out other than to join them in preparation for the coming of... well, I don't want to ruin it for you".

The proposed sixth "Hellraiser" movie is being worked on before number five - "Hellraiser: Hellseeker" - is even released in the US on 15 October!

"MEET THE FOCKERS" - Shooting Now???

The US 'TV Guide' has reported that "Meet The Fockers", the sequel to "Meet The Parents" with Robert DeNiro and Ben Stiller is currently shooting! Perhaps this is an error on their part, but has director Jay Roach launched himself into another movie so soon after "Austin Powers In Goldmember"?

"RUSH HOUR 3 & 4?" - Ratner Abandones #4

Director Brett Ratner has admitted that he may not shoot two further "Rush Hour" sequels back-to-back, but start "Rush Hour 3" in January 2004. The current plan is to start the movie in New York and then a country where both Jackie Chan and Chris Tucker's characters are fish out of water.

"SPIDER-MAN 2" - Screenwriters Spin Their Story...

Alfred Gough and Miles Millar (creators/writers of "Smallville") have spoken about their next project - writing the sequel to this Summer's hit "Spider-Man":

"We can't really talk too much about the story-because the "X-Men" will be sent out to kill us-but you will see Peter grow and evolve. That's really the story Sam wants to tell. You'll see him grow as a person, a superhero and in all his relationships."

So how did the creators of "Smallville" get involved with Spider-Man? Gough: "We got a call from 'Columbia Pictures' and we went and had a meeting. They actually took us over to the set of the first "Spider-Man" and we met Sam Raimi, Tobey Maguire, and [Producer] Laura Ziskin. And they basically said they'd like us to consider writing the sequel because they really like "Smallville" and "Shanghai Noon". And you call us up and invite us to the set like that, nine out of 10 our answer will be 'yes.'"

"We were told once, 'You guys had done the Marvel Comics version of 'Superman'.' So to have 'Marvel Comics' come to us and ask us to get involved in this, that was a real thrill!"

Millar: "We've read a lot of comics now and we've also read the 'Ultimate Spider-Man' books. We have definitely done our homework."

"STAR TREK NEMESIS" - Is It The End?

Patrick Stewart has commented that: "If this is the end of 'The Next Generation', it's actually a beautiful and appropriate ending. There is complete closure on 'The Next Generation' in this movie."

He also confirmed that the new movie "Star Trek Nemesis" will feature cameos from stars of "Star Trek: Deep Space Nine" and "Star Trek: Voyager" (Kate Mulgrew as Admiral Janeway).

Cover "SUPERMAN 5" - Up, Up & Away?

More information has arrived on the J.J Abrams' screenplay that impressed 'Warner Brothers' recently. Insiders have christened the script "Superman: The Man Of Steel".

Producers David Heyman ("Harry Potter") and Barrie M. Osbourne ("The Lord Of The Rings") are involved in the project, and original "Superman" director Richard Donner is being asked to become an executive-producer on the new movie!

It has also been speculated that Brendar Fraser ("The Mummy") could play Superman following his multi-picture deal with 'Warner Brothers'!

And who will direct? Well, as I said last issue, "Charlie's Angels" helmer McG could be pushed out of the frame by one of the following: Stephen Sommers ("The Mummy"), Stephen Hopkins ("Lost In Space"), Kevin Reynolds ("Robin Hood: Prince Of Thieves), Robert Rodriguez ("Spy Kids 2") or the current favourite Brett Ratner ("Rush Hour").

"TREMORS 4" - Tunnelling To TV...

"Tremors 4" is about to begin shooting at FOX Studios Baja, together with the pilot for a television series.

"WOLFENSTEIN" - Game-To-Screen?

'ID Software' CEO Todd Hollenshead has spoken about plans to adapt computer games "Doom" and "Wolfenstein" into movies. He said: ""Of course, movies based on PC and video game properties continue to be hot and recently 'Sony' announced plans to make a 'Return To Castle Wolfenstein' film."

Hollenshead has met with the producers of the game and was impressed with their enthusiasm for both the game and making the movie. The producers are currently looking to secure a writer for the "Wolfenstein" movie. The "Doom III" E3 demonstration in Los Angeles also caught the eye of some Hollywood producers, according to Hollenshead. He also said 'id' is currently looking at a number of ideas for a "Doom" movie...

"xXx2" - $22 million!

Vin Diesel is said to be getting $22 million and 3% of the total gross of the sequel to "xXx" once it's made! This firmly put Diesel amongst the biggest earners in Hollywood - not bad for a relative unknown just 6 months ago!
